How We Restore Your Tile Floor to Its Former Glory

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ure that your tile floor is restored to its original condition. We understand that water damage can be unpredictable, and that’s why we’re committed to providing a fast and effective solution. Here’s an overview of our process:

Step 1: Assessment and Containment

We’ll send a team of experts to your property to assess the damage and contain the affected area. This ensures that the water doesn’t spread to other parts of your home and that our technicians can work safely and efficiently.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We’ll use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from your tile floor. This includes powerful pumps and wet vacuums that can remove up to 2 inches of standing water in a single pass.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Our team will use high-velocity air movers and dehumidifiers to dry your tile floor and surrounding areas. This process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age.

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fecting

Once the drying process is complete, our team will clean and disinfect your tile floor to remove any remaining moisture, dirt, and bacteria.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ups

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your tile floor is completely dry and free of any remaining damage. We’ll also make any necessary touch-ups to ensure that your floor looks and feels like new.

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Wheaton, MD

The cost of tile floor water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Wheaton, MD.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 The cost of water extraction depends on the amount of water and the equipment needed.
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 The cost of drying and dehumidification dep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ment needed.
Cleaning and Disinfecting $500 – $2,000 The cost of cleaning and disinfecting dep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ment needed.
Final Inspection and Touch-ups $500 – $2,000 The cost of final inspection and touch-ups dep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ment needed.

Common Questions About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ration

What causes tile floor water damage?

Tile floor water damage can be caused by a variety of factors, including burst pipes, leaky roofs, and clogged drains. It’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.

How long does tile floor water damage restoration take?

The length of time required for tile floor water damage restoration depends on the severity of the damage and the equipment needed. In most cases, our team can complete the restoration process within 3-5 days.

Can I prevent tile floor water damage?

Yes, you can take steps to prevent tile floor water damage, including inspecting your pipes regularly, fixing leaks quickly, and keeping your drains clear. Regular maintenance can help prevent costly repairs and ensure your home remains safe and healthy.

What happens if I don’t address tile floor water damage?

If you don’t address tile floor water damage, it can lead to further damage, costly repairs, and health risks. It’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ent these consequences and ensure your home remains safe and healthy.
